Qualifications
It is crucial to possess the right qualifications and certificates to be a Gas Engineer. They are responsible for the safe and efficient repair of various gas appliances, including boilers, wall heaters, and gas cookers. They also provide regular inspections of gas appliances and flues to ensure that they're working in a safe manner. In addition, they must be able to comprehend and interpret technical documents, for example, the instructions for servicing and installation for boilers.
Gas Safe Register is one of the most important qualifications a gas engineer can earn. This is required for all people who work on gas appliances in the UK. Anyone who works on

Another qualification that is required for gas engineers is an ACS in Gas. This is a course that tests the skills of a gas engineer about domestic and commercial systems. To attain the highest quality of qualifications for this career it is essential to select a training centre with state-of-the-art facilities and knowledgeable instructors. For example the Gastec training center offers a variety of courses to prepare students for the ACS examination.
Apprenticeships are a great way to gain valuable experience in the field of gas engineering. These apprenticeships provide on-the-job learning and pay a wage when you finish your education. These programmes are available throughout the country and can be completed in as little as to five years. You can also take an organized learning program that is fast-tracked. Work environment
Gas Engineers Milton Keynes can be employed in a variety of settings. They are responsible for installing and maintaining commercial heating equipment like burners and boilers. They can also respond to emergencies when needed. To succeed in their job, they must have ACS qualifications as well as an official driving license. They must also be registered on the Gas Safe Register for Great Britain, Isle of Man and Guernsey. This is a complete list of gas companies that is maintained by Capita Business Services Ltd. It is the only way to find gas engineers who are registered to legally work in Great Britain.
Requirements
Gas engineers must have excellent problem-solving skills and also be able to communicate effectively. They must be able to adhere to safety guidelines and procedures. They should be able to spot the signs of failure and fix equipment quickly. They must have the ability to work with various types of appliances including liquid and natural gas. They should also be able to perform several tests to evaluate their performance.
Gas engineers must possess an official Gas Safe certificate before they can work on gas appliances. These certificates can be obtained through the Gas Safe Register, which has replaced CORGI. The new system is easier to use and faster. It is also completely free. Additionally the Gas Safe Register will provide an official list of certified engineers that are dependable.
